How you make a difference:
The Clinical Services Coordinator is responsible for the smooth day-to-day operations of clinics, including staffing, scheduling, intake, pharmacy, and managing sick calls.
Key Responsibilities:
- Coordinate and oversee all nursing staff activities, including scheduling, health assessments, and patient care plans.
- Ensure compliance with state guidelines and policies, and identify potential issues and propose corrective actions.
- Maintain accurate records and statistics, including staffing levels, inventory, and patient care.
- Assist with staff training and evaluations, and conduct regular meetings to identify problems and propose solutions.
- Maintain a professional and high standard of patient care and attend institutional staff meetings as directed.
Qualifications & Requirements:
Education
- Graduation from an accredited School of Nursing
Experience
- Prefer a minimum of one-year clinical experience; Minimum of one-year correctional experience; Minimum of one-year of supervisor/scheduling experience;
Licenses/Certifications
- Must have and maintain current licensure as a Licensed Practical Nurse or Registered Nurse within the State (minimum requirement)
- Must be able to obtain and maintain CPR certification.
